Keep in mind … WebEnable Flight Go to your Game server > Settings > server.properties page and change "allow-flight=false" to "allow-flight=true".
WebLocate "Settings" on the left tab and enter it. Find "server.properties" and click on "Change". Scroll down and find the setting that says "allow-flight". Change "allow-flight=false" to "allow-flight=true" and click "Save. There is no direct command in Minecraft that will make you fly. You can change the mode of the game using the "/gamemode creative" command, and this will allow you to press jump twice to get you up in the air. If you want to fly even faster (on PC), you can go into Spectator mode.
